v. 25B6; verb
adverts preceded the film : GO/COME BEFORE, lead (up) to, pave/prepare the way for, herald, introduce, usher in; archaic forgo.
Catherine preceded him into the studio : GO AHEAD OF, go in front of, go before, go first, lead the way.
he preceded the book with a poem : PREFACE, introduce, begin, open.
follow.
